What is Digital Marketing?

Digital marketing is the process of promoting products, services, or brands using the internet and digital platforms. Instead of traditional marketing methods like newspapers, TV ads, or banners, digital marketing focuses on online channels such as Google, social media, websites, emails, and mobile apps.

In simple words, whenever you see an advertisement on Instagram, YouTube, Google, or Facebook, that is digital marketing.

Businesses use digital marketing to:

  • Reach more customers online
  • Generate leads and sales
  • Build brand awareness
  • Increase website traffic
  • Grow social media presence
  • Improve customer engagement

Digital marketing has become essential because people now spend most of their time online. From shopping and learning to entertainment and communication, everything is happening digitally.

That is why companies are investing heavily in online marketing strategies and hiring skilled digital marketers.


Major Types of Digital Marketing

1. Search Engine Optimization (SEO)

SEO is the process of improving a website’s visibility on search engines like Google.

For example, when someone searches “best digital marketing course after 12th” on Google, websites ranking on the first page use SEO strategies.

SEO includes:

  • Keyword research
  • On-page optimization
  • Link building
  • Technical SEO
  • Content optimization

SEO professionals help websites get organic traffic without paid advertisements.


2. Social Media Marketing (SMM)

Social media marketing involves promoting brands on platforms like:

  • Instagram
  • Facebook
  • LinkedIn
  • Twitter/X
  • Pinterest
  • Snapchat

Businesses use social media to:

  • Engage with audiences
  • Build followers
  • Run advertisements
  • Increase sales
  • Promote products

Social media marketing is one of the most creative career options in digital marketing.


3. Google Ads (Pay-Per-Click Advertising)

Google Ads allows businesses to run paid advertisements on Google search results, YouTube, and partner websites.

For example:
If someone searches “digital marketing institute in Mumbai,” Google may show sponsored ads at the top.

Digital marketers create and manage these advertising campaigns to generate leads and sales.


4. Content Marketing

Content marketing focuses on creating valuable content to attract customers.

This includes:

  • Blog articles
  • Videos
  • Infographics
  • Podcasts
  • Case studies
  • E-books

Content marketing helps businesses build trust and authority online.


5. Email Marketing

Email marketing is one of the oldest yet most effective digital marketing strategies.

Companies send emails to:

  • Promote offers
  • Share updates
  • Generate sales
  • Retain customers

A good email marketing strategy can significantly increase conversions and customer loyalty.


6. YouTube Marketing

YouTube is the second-largest search engine after Google. Businesses and creators use YouTube marketing to:

  • Build audiences
  • Generate leads
  • Increase sales
  • Create brand awareness

Video content is growing rapidly, making YouTube marketing an excellent career skill.


7. Affiliate Marketing

Affiliate marketing allows individuals to earn commissions by promoting products online.

For example:
A blogger or influencer shares affiliate links for products and earns money whenever someone purchases through those links.

Many students start affiliate marketing while learning digital marketing skills.

Types of Digital Marketing Courses After 12th

There are multiple types of digital marketing courses available for students after 12th. Choosing the right course depends on your career goals, budget, and learning preference.


1. Certificate Courses

Certificate courses are short-term programs focused on practical digital marketing skills.

Duration:

  • 2 to 6 months

Best For:

  • Beginners
  • Students wanting quick skill development
  • Freelancing beginners

Topics Covered:

  • SEO
  • Social media marketing
  • Google Ads
  • Content marketing
  • Basics of analytics

Average Fees:

  • ₹15,000 to ₹50,000

Certificate courses are ideal for students who want to start quickly without investing too much time or money.


2. Diploma Courses

Diploma courses provide more in-depth training compared to certificate programs.

Duration:

  • 6 months to 1 year

Best For:

  • Students seeking job-ready skills
  • Those wanting placements and internships

Topics Covered:

  • Advanced SEO
  • Performance marketing
  • Meta Ads
  • Email marketing
  • Website planning
  • Automation tools

Average Fees:

  • ₹40,000 to ₹1,20,000

Many reputed institutes offer diploma programs with live projects and certifications.


3. Advanced Digital Marketing Programs

Advanced programs are designed for students who want comprehensive industry-level training.

Duration:

  • 8 months to 18 months

Includes:

  • Internship opportunities
  • Live projects
  • Agency training
  • Industry certifications
  • Placement support

Average Fees:

  • ₹80,000 to ₹2,50,000

These programs are suitable for students serious about building long-term careers in digital marketing.


4. Online Digital Marketing Courses

Online learning has become extremely popular after the growth of e-learning platforms.

Advantages:

  • Learn from home
  • Flexible schedule
  • Affordable pricing
  • Access to global trainers

Popular Platforms:

  • Google Digital Garage
  • HubSpot Academy
  • Coursera
  • Udemy
  • Simplilearn

Average Fees:

  • Free to ₹80,000

Online courses are ideal for self-motivated learners.


5. Offline Classroom Training

Offline courses provide classroom-based practical learning.

Benefits:

  • Direct trainer interaction
  • Networking opportunities
  • Better discipline
  • Hands-on guidance

Best For:

  • Students who prefer classroom environments
  • Beginners needing structured learning

Fresher Salary in Digital Marketing

Students who complete a course and gain practical skills can apply for entry-level positions.

Average Fresher Salary

Job RoleAverage Starting Salary
SEO Executive₹15,000 – ₹30,000/month
Social Media Executive₹18,000 – ₹35,000/month
Content Writer₹15,000 – ₹40,000/month
Google Ads Executive₹25,000 – ₹45,000/month
Email Marketing Executive₹20,000 – ₹35,000/month
Digital Marketing Intern₹5,000 – ₹15,000/month

Students with internships and live project experience usually get better salary packages.


Experienced Digital Marketing Salary

After gaining 2–5 years of experience, digital marketers can earn significantly higher salaries.

Experience LevelAverage Annual Salary
1–2 Years₹3 LPA – ₹5 LPA
3–5 Years₹6 LPA – ₹12 LPA
5–8 Years₹10 LPA – ₹20 LPA
8+ Years₹20 LPA+

Specialists in performance marketing, SEO, and marketing automation often earn higher salaries.

Agency Jobs vs In-House Jobs

Students entering digital marketing usually work either in agencies or directly with companies.

Agency Jobs

Advantages:

  • Faster learning
  • Multiple client exposure
  • Better experience
  • Team environment

Disadvantages:

  • Higher workload
  • Tight deadlines

In-House Jobs

Advantages:

  • Stable work environment
  • Focus on one brand
  • Better work-life balance

Disadvantages:

  • Slower learning initially
  • Limited exposure

For beginners, agencies are often the best place to gain practical experience quickly.

How to Start Freelancing in Digital Marketing

Step 1: Learn One Core Skill

Start with one specialization such as:

  • SEO
  • Social media marketing
  • Content writing
  • Meta Ads
  • Canva designing

Avoid learning everything at once initially.


Step 2: Build a Portfolio

Create:

  • Sample Instagram pages
  • Demo websites
  • SEO case studies
  • Sample ad campaigns
  • Blog articles

A portfolio helps clients trust your skills.


Step 3: Create LinkedIn and Instagram Presence

Personal branding is extremely important.

Post content about:

  • Marketing tips
  • Learning journey
  • Case studies
  • Results
  • Industry trends

Consistency helps attract opportunities.


Step 4: Start on Freelancing Platforms

Popular platforms include:

  • Fiverr
  • Upwork
  • Freelancer
  • PeoplePerHour

Initially, focus on gaining reviews and testimonials.


Step 5: Network with Local Businesses

Many small businesses need affordable digital marketing help.

You can approach:

  • Cafes
  • Gyms
  • Salons
  • Local stores
  • Coaches
  • Startups

Offer beginner-friendly packages to get your first clients.
